Levemir FlexPen: A Comprehensive Overview

Managing diabetes effectively requires a reliable and convenient insulin delivery system. Levemir FlexPen, a pre-filled pen containing insulin detemir, offers a solution for precise and consistent blood sugar control. Its ease of use and accurate dosing make it a popular choice among patients.

Levemir FlexPen is a basal insulin designed to provide a long-acting, steady release of insulin into the bloodstream. This helps maintain stable blood glucose levels throughout the day and night, preventing overnight highs and lows. Unlike some other insulins, Levemir boasts a predictable and consistent profile, minimizing the risk of unexpected fluctuations.

The FlexPen delivery system offers a user-friendly and accurate method for administering insulin. Each pen contains a precise dose of insulin, eliminating the need for manual measurements and reducing the chances of dosing errors. This simplified approach enhances patient compliance and improves overall diabetes management. The pre-filled design simplifies the injection process.

Importantly, remember that Levemir FlexPen is not suitable for treating diabetic ketoacidosis. Always consult your healthcare provider for appropriate treatment options.

What is Levemir FlexPen?

Levemir FlexPen is a pre-filled pen delivering insulin detemir, a long-acting basal insulin analog. Designed for subcutaneous injection, it aids in managing blood glucose levels in adults and children with diabetes mellitus. The 3ml pen provides a convenient and accurate method for administering a consistent dose of insulin, contributing to better glycemic control.

This insulin’s unique formulation provides a flat and predictable insulin profile, lasting up to 24 hours. Unlike some other insulin types, its prolonged action minimizes the risk of significant blood sugar fluctuations throughout the day and night, particularly beneficial for maintaining stable overnight glucose levels. This consistent release is crucial for preventing both hypoglycemic and hyperglycemic events.

The FlexPen design simplifies insulin administration. The pre-filled pen eliminates the need for manual insulin drawing and measuring, reducing the potential for dosing errors. This user-friendly feature improves adherence to treatment regimens, a significant factor in effective diabetes management. The pen’s ease of use contributes to a higher quality of life for patients.

It’s vital to understand that Levemir FlexPen is not intended for treating diabetic ketoacidosis (DKA). This condition requires immediate medical attention and a different treatment approach. Always consult your healthcare provider regarding appropriate management of DKA or any other acute diabetic complications.

How Levemir FlexPen Works

Levemir FlexPen contains insulin detemir, a long-acting insulin analog designed for once- or twice-daily subcutaneous administration. Unlike rapid-acting insulins, detemir’s action is gradual and sustained, providing a steady basal level of insulin throughout the day and night. This controlled release helps prevent significant blood sugar fluctuations, particularly the sharp rises often seen in the absence of basal insulin.

The mechanism of action involves the binding of insulin detemir to albumin in the bloodstream. This binding creates a reservoir of insulin that slowly dissociates and becomes available to tissues, resulting in a prolonged effect. The duration of action extends for up to 24 hours, offering consistent glucose control without the frequent dosing needed for shorter-acting insulins. This extended effect contributes to improved glycemic control and reduced risk of hypoglycemia.

The flat and predictable pharmacokinetic profile of Levemir is a key advantage. This means that the insulin is released consistently, leading to a more stable blood sugar level throughout the dosing interval. This predictability makes it easier for both patients and healthcare providers to manage diabetes effectively. The consistent blood sugar levels provided by Levemir contribute to better overall health outcomes.

Individual dosage adjustments are necessary to optimize treatment effects. The precise dose and administration schedule should always be determined and monitored by a qualified healthcare professional. Factors such as diet, exercise, and other medications can influence insulin requirements and necessitate adjustments to maintain optimal glycemic control. Regular blood glucose monitoring is crucial to guide dose adjustments.

Important Safety Information and Usage

Hypoglycemia (low blood sugar) is a potential adverse effect of Levemir FlexPen, especially when used in conjunction with other medications or in the presence of underlying conditions. Symptoms can range from mild (shakiness, sweating) to severe (loss of consciousness), necessitating prompt treatment with glucose. Careful monitoring of blood glucose levels is crucial to minimize this risk.

Allergic reactions, though rare, can occur. Symptoms may include skin rash, itching, swelling, or difficulty breathing. If an allergic reaction is suspected, discontinue use immediately and seek medical attention. Proper training on insulin injection techniques and recognition of allergic reaction symptoms are vital for patient safety.

Injection site reactions, such as redness, swelling, or itching, are possible. Rotating injection sites can help mitigate this. Always use a clean needle for each injection to prevent infection. Proper injection technique minimizes discomfort and reduces the risk of local complications.

Weight gain is a potential side effect of insulin therapy, including Levemir. Maintaining a healthy diet and regular exercise are essential to manage weight and overall health. Consult your doctor or a registered dietitian for guidance on a balanced meal plan and appropriate physical activity levels to mitigate potential weight gain.

Do not share Levemir FlexPens or needles with others, even if the needle is changed. This is crucial to prevent the transmission of bloodborne diseases. Strict adherence to aseptic injection techniques is paramount to ensure patient safety and prevent cross-contamination.

Levemir FlexPen Administration

Levemir FlexPen is designed for subcutaneous injection, meaning the insulin is injected under the skin. Common injection sites include the abdomen, thigh, and upper arm. Rotating injection sites helps prevent lipohypertrophy (thickening of the skin at the injection site) and ensures consistent insulin absorption.

Before administering the injection, carefully inspect the pen for any damage or particulate matter in the solution. Ensure the dose is correctly set according to your healthcare provider’s instructions. A new needle should be attached before each injection to maintain sterility and prevent cross-contamination.

Injecting Levemir requires a gentle pinching of the skin at the chosen injection site to create a subcutaneous fat fold. Insert the needle at a 90-degree angle, smoothly and steadily. After injection, gently withdraw the needle, and apply gentle pressure to the injection site with a cotton ball or gauze pad (no rubbing).

The injection technique should be demonstrated and regularly reviewed by a healthcare professional to ensure proper technique and minimize the risk of complications. Patients should be thoroughly trained on the use of the pen and proper disposal of used needles. Consistent and correct injection technique is vital for the effective delivery of Levemir.

Always follow your doctor’s instructions regarding the frequency of injections, the dosage, and the injection sites. Regular monitoring of blood glucose levels is essential to gauge the effectiveness of the treatment and to make necessary adjustments to the dosage regimen under medical supervision. This ensures optimal glycemic control and minimizes risks.

Levemir FlexPen: Pros

Levemir FlexPen offers several key advantages for managing diabetes. Its long-acting nature provides consistent blood sugar control, minimizing the risk of significant fluctuations throughout the day and night. This predictable insulin profile simplifies diabetes management and contributes to a higher quality of life for patients. The reduced fluctuation minimizes the risk of both hypo- and hyperglycemic episodes.

The convenient pre-filled pen design simplifies insulin administration, eliminating the need for manual measurement and reducing the risk of dosing errors. This user-friendly system improves medication adherence, a crucial factor in effective diabetes management. The ease of use promotes better patient compliance and reduces the burden of daily insulin administration.

The flat and predictable insulin profile of Levemir is another significant benefit. This consistent release ensures stable blood sugar levels, unlike some other insulin types that can cause more pronounced peaks and troughs. This consistency is particularly beneficial for preventing nocturnal hypoglycemia. The predictable profile also facilitates easier dose adjustments.

Many patients appreciate the reduced risk of weight gain associated with Levemir compared to some other insulin types. While weight management remains important for overall health, this characteristic can be an advantage for individuals concerned about weight changes associated with insulin therapy. Individual responses may vary, but this is a commonly reported benefit.

Finally, the ease of use and portability of the FlexPen makes it ideal for managing diabetes on the go. This discreet and convenient delivery system allows for seamless integration into daily routines and enhances flexibility for patients. This portability is a significant benefit for those with active lifestyles.

Levemir FlexPen: Cons

While Levemir FlexPen offers many benefits, potential drawbacks should be considered. Hypoglycemia, or low blood sugar, is a recognized risk with all insulin therapies, including Levemir. Symptoms can vary in severity and require prompt treatment with glucose. Careful blood glucose monitoring and adherence to prescribed dosage are crucial to minimize this risk. Adjustments to medication or lifestyle may be necessary to effectively control blood sugar levels.

Injection site reactions, such as redness, swelling, or itching, can occur. Rotating injection sites and using proper injection techniques can help minimize these reactions. However, some individuals may experience more frequent or severe reactions, necessitating discussion with their healthcare provider. Monitoring for any unusual reactions at the injection site is important.

Although less common, allergic reactions to insulin detemir are possible. Symptoms can range from mild skin reactions to severe systemic reactions, requiring immediate medical attention. Patients should be aware of potential allergy symptoms and seek medical help if they occur. Early recognition and prompt treatment of allergic reactions are critical.

Levemir’s long duration of action, while beneficial for maintaining stable glucose levels, can also make it more challenging to correct for unexpected hyperglycemia. If a significant rise in blood sugar occurs, it may take longer for Levemir to respond compared to shorter-acting insulins. Careful planning of meal timing and insulin dosing is important to mitigate this.

Finally, the cost of Levemir FlexPen may be a concern for some patients. Insulin costs can vary significantly, and this factor should be discussed with healthcare providers and insurance companies to ensure accessibility. Exploring various cost-saving options or alternative insulin therapies may be necessary depending on individual circumstances.

Alternatives to Levemir FlexPen

Several alternative basal insulin options exist for managing diabetes, each with its own characteristics and suitability depending on individual patient needs and preferences. The choice of an alternative should always be made in consultation with a healthcare professional to ensure optimal glycemic control and minimize potential adverse effects. Careful consideration of individual factors is crucial.

Tresiba (insulin degludec) is a long-acting basal insulin with an even longer duration of action than Levemir. This extended duration might require less frequent injections for some individuals. However, its longer duration of action may also make it more challenging to adjust for unexpected hyperglycemia. The extended duration can be both an advantage and a disadvantage depending on individual needs.

Toujeo (insulin glargine 300 U/mL) offers a high concentration of insulin glargine, allowing for a smaller injection volume. This may be beneficial for patients who prefer smaller injections or have difficulty with larger injection volumes. However, the higher concentration requires careful attention to dosage accuracy to avoid errors. The higher concentration can be advantageous but also requires careful management.

Other basal insulins, such as insulin glargine (Lantus) or insulin detemir (Levemir in vial form), represent alternative formulations that may suit individual needs. Factors such as cost, ease of use, and personal preferences may influence the selection of a specific insulin product. The availability of different formulations provides choice and flexibility.

Beyond basal insulins, non-insulin therapies, such as GLP-1 receptor agonists or SGLT2 inhibitors, may be considered as part of a comprehensive diabetes management plan. These medications offer alternative approaches to blood glucose control and may be used in combination with insulin or as monotherapy. These alternatives broaden treatment options and allow for personalized approaches.
